#8c28c8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8c28c8 is composed of 54.9% red, 15.7%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30% cyan, 80%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 277.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 47.1%. #8c28c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ff50ff with #190091.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#8c28c8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030104 is the darkest color, while #f9f3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8c28c8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a727e is the less saturated color, while #9503ed is the most saturated one.
